Softball Recap: Desert Christian Eagles vs. Benson Bobcats
If Desert Christian was feeling good fresh off their 31-5 takedown of San Miguel last Tuesday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Eagles fell just short of the Benson Bobcats by a score of 10-9 on Friday. The loss continues a trend for the Eagles in their meetings with the Bobcats: they've now lost eight in a row.

Alexa Yarger stepped up to lead a balanced group of hitters: she got on base in all five of her plate appearances with one home run, three RBI, and one double. She is on a roll when it comes to home runs, as she's now launched at least one in each of the last five games she's played. Another player making a difference was Lilly Crawford, who scored a run and stole a base while going 2-for-4.
Desert Christian's defeat dropped their record down to 3-10. As for Benson, their victory was their third straight at home, which pushed their record up to 10-10.
Coincidentally, Desert Christian and Benson will both be playing Tombstone the next time they take the field. The Eagles will head out to face the Yellow Jackets at 3:45 p.m. on Monday, while the Bobcats will host them at 4:00 p.m. on Thursday.
